在当今数字化时代,保护个人和系统密码的安全至关重要。Ubuntu作为一款流行的开源操作系统,其密码安全同样不容忽视。本文将详细介绍如何保护Ubuntu系统密码安全,并提供一些案例分析,帮助您更好地理解和应用这些技巧。
一、使用强密码
1.1 强密码的定义
强密码通常包含以下特点:
- 长度:至少8位或更多
- 复杂度:包含大小写字母、数字和特殊字符
- 避免常见密码:如123456、password等
- 不可预测:避免使用生日、姓名等个人信息
1.2 设置强密码的方法
- 打开终端,输入以下命令:
passwd - 按照提示输入当前密码,然后输入新密码。确保新密码符合强密码的要求。
二、启用密码保护
2.1 启用登录密码
- 打开终端,输入以下命令:
sudo passwd - 按照提示输入当前密码,然后输入新密码。
2.2 启用SSH密码登录
- 打开终端,输入以下命令:
sudo nano /etc/ssh/sshd_config - 找到
PasswordAuthentication行,将其值更改为yes。 - 保存并退出编辑器,重启SSH服务:
sudo systemctl restart ssh
三、定期更改密码
3.1 定期更改密码的重要性
定期更改密码可以有效降低密码被破解的风险。
3.2 更改密码的方法
- 打开终端,输入以下命令:
passwd - 按照提示输入当前密码,然后输入新密码。
四、使用密码管理器
4.1 密码管理器的优势
- 安全:密码管理器可以存储大量密码,且安全性较高。
- 便捷:只需记住一个主密码即可解锁所有密码。
- 自动填充:自动填充密码,提高工作效率。
4.2 常见的密码管理器
- LastPass
- KeePass
- 1Password
五、案例分析
5.1 案例一:弱密码导致账户被盗
某用户使用简单密码登录Ubuntu系统,导致账户被盗。黑客通过破解密码,获取了用户的重要信息。
5.2 案例二:启用SSH密码登录
某用户未启用SSH密码登录,导致服务器被非法访问。黑客通过SSH登录,获取了服务器上的敏感信息。
六、总结
保护Ubuntu系统密码安全是每个用户都需要关注的问题。通过使用强密码、启用密码保护、定期更改密码和使用密码管理器等实用技巧,可以有效降低密码被破解的风险。同时,通过案例分析,我们也可以了解到密码安全的重要性。希望本文能帮助您更好地保护Ubuntu系统密码安全。
